(-1)^2 × (-1)^3 × (-1)^5​

Mathematics
1 answer:
____ [38]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

1

Step-by-step explanation:

(-1)^2 = 1

(-1)^3 = -1

(-1)^5 = -1

(1) (-1) (-1) = 1
